The regions german They asked the government this Saturday to tighten the rules of entry into the territory and prohibit arrivals from the United Kingdom to slow the spread of omicron variant.
In a videoconference, the health ministers of the 16 federal states asked that passengers over 6 years of age be forced to carry out a PCR test of less than 48 hours, compared to the current 12, from countries highly affected by this new variant. of the coronavirus. Rapid antigen tests should no longer be accepted.
“We have to delay the spread” of this “worrying” and “highly contagious” variant for as long as possible, Klaus Holetschek from Bavaria stressed in a statement.
The new Health Minister Karl Lauterbach welcomed the proposal.
“The longer we can postpone the moment when omicron has us under control, the better,” he said after the meeting, in which he also participated.
Regional ministers also called for the UK to be “quickly” included in the category of highly affected territories, which currently includes South Africa and seven other African countries.
This decision would constitute a de facto travel ban from the UK, except for German citizens.
Several European countries, such as France, have already taken measures to limit the entry of travelers from the United Kingdom.
